Transaction 34de75b6023b56a2f0dcd11a0fe780481ea7d824d67cd60b72aca8b3426bcc65
1 Input
2 Outputs
- 34de75b6023b56a2f0dcd11a0fe780481ea7d824d67cd60b72aca8b3426bcc65:0
- 34de75b6023b56a2f0dcd11a0fe780481ea7d824d67cd60b72aca8b3426bcc65:1
value 3541
address 1AARQCUrTWPhEKLooTCEUBLFxwDxjA1M3s
value 12074400
address 127V5UpMrqq5s9tjhwNxRiDFDzziDitgkH